Are Puma Shoes Machine Washable?
When it comes to washing Puma shoes, it’s essential to check the care instructions provided by the manufacturer. In general, most Puma shoes are not designed to be machine washed. The harsh spinning and tumbling in the washing machine can damage the materials and affect the shape of the shoes. It’s best to avoid putting your Puma shoes in the washing machine unless the manufacturer specifically states that they are machine washable.
How to Clean Puma Shoes
While machine washing is not recommended for most Puma shoes, you can still clean them effectively by hand. Here are some steps to follow when cleaning your Puma shoes:
Materials Needed:
- Mild detergent
- Soft-bristled brush or sponge
- Water
- Cloth
Steps To Clean Puma Shoes:
- Remove the laces and insoles from your Puma shoes.
- Prepare a mixture of mild detergent and water.
- Dip a soft-bristled brush or sponge into the soapy water.
- Gently scrub the exterior of your Puma shoes with the brush or sponge.
- Use a damp cloth to wipe off any excess soap.
- Air dry your Puma shoes away from direct heat or sunlight.
- Once dry, reinsert the insoles and laces.
Special Care for Different Puma Shoe Materials
Depending on the material of your Puma shoes, you may need to take special care when cleaning them. Here are some tips for cleaning different types of Puma shoe materials:
Shoe Material | Cleaning Method |
---|---|
Leather | Use a leather cleaner or conditioner to clean and protect the material. |
Suede/Nubuck | Brush the material gently with a suede brush to remove dirt and stains. |
Mesh/Fabric | Hand wash with mild detergent and air dry to prevent damage to the material. |
Tips for Maintaining Your Puma Shoes
Regular maintenance is key to keeping your Puma shoes looking fresh and clean. Here are some tips to help you maintain your Puma shoes:
- Store your Puma shoes in a cool, dry place away from direct sunlight.
- Clean your Puma shoes regularly to prevent dirt and stains from setting in.
- Avoid wearing your Puma shoes in harsh weather conditions or rough terrains.
- Rotate your Puma shoes to allow them to air out and prevent odor buildup.
- Replace worn-out insoles to maintain the comfort and support of your Puma shoes.
